A conceptual modeling framework for discrete event. Gmf tooling the gmf tooling project provides a model driven approach to generating graphical editors in eclipse. Graph modelling framework gmf is a software to develop and implement. Modelling pdf pdf modelling of turbulent mixing in stratified fluids. Therefore, we introduce control structures that add more flexibility in the abstraction and conceptual modeling process. The results show that the bridge information modeling framework can potentially facilitate the integration of information involved in bridge monitoring applications, and effectively support and. Mapping conceptual to logical models for etl processes. Motivated by the emergence of multimodel ensembles as a research avenue. The framework presented in this section, hierarchical control conceptual modeling hccm, breaks with the assumption that all des models are best represented by queuing systems. The requirements modeling framework rmf is an opensource software framework for working with requirements based on the reqif standard. Using a reallife evolution taken from the graphical modeling framework, we invite submissions to explore ways in which model transformation and migration. Chapter 8 hierarchical models in the generalized linear models weve looked at so far, weve assumed that the observations are independent of each other given the predictor variables.
Feature models are used to specify members of a productline. Graph modelling framework gmf is a software to develop and implement extendable customized tools for graph model based analysis. Multiorder graphical model selection in pathways and temporal networks ingo scholtes eth zurich. Chapter 8 hierarchical models university of california. Eclipse development using the graphical editing framework and. The eclipse modeling framework emf provides a modeling and code. For the modeling of the default features, a parametric approach was chosen because it is often easier to define generalization operators in terms of characteristic parameters and parametric models can ensure many constraints implicitly. Gef graphical editing framework is a java technology, it is a part of the eclipse framework developed by ibm. The results of this competition are given in table 1. An ontology oriented architecture for context aware services adaptation hatim guermah 1, tarik fissaa, hatim hafiddi 1 2, mahmoud nassar1 and abdelaziz kriouile 1 ims team, sime lab, ensias, mohammed v souissi university, rabat, morocco 2 isl team, strs lab, inpt, rabat, morocco abstract in the field of ubiquitous computing, a class of applications called. Code a software framework for agentbased simulation. The goal of any modeling activity is a complete and accurate understanding of the realworld domain, within the bounds of the problem at hand and keeping in mind the goals of the stakeholders involved. The eclipse graphical modeling project gmp provides a set of generative components and runtime infrastructures for developing graphical editors based on emf and gef.
Graphical modeling framework architecture overview eclipsecon. Learning data modelling by example database answers. This paper proposes a modeling framework a set of metamodels and a set of design catalogues for requirements analysis of data analytics systems. However, there are many situations in which that type of independence does not hold. Durable models best practice for oems using ibm cognos bi. Introduction to the generic eclipse modeling system sunsite icm. The modeling framework consists of three interacting modules. We present an evaluation of the graphical modeling framework gmf based on our experiences in developing an editor for the risk modeling language. Gmf leverages the eclipse modeling framework emf and the eclipse graphical editing framework gef to.
Content modeling framework item business object references binding purpose allows cmf documents to have an indirect association with other plm items business objects document element becomes a proxy to the bus. Graphical modeling framework how is graphical modeling. Data analytics is an essential element for success in modern enterprises. An evaluation of the graphical modeling framework gmf i accept. The framework of probabilistic graphical models, presented in this book, provides a general approach for this task. Graphical definition of inplace transformations in the eclipse. Comparing modelling frameworks a workshop approach. It relies on a model, based on entityrelationship modelling, that describes how the two worlds map to each other.
In this paper we explore conceptual modeling first with an illustrative example from a healthcare setting. A conceptual modeling framework for business analytics. The structure of a tree is well known and it is important to enforce the sequence of types in the levels of the hierarchy. Modelling pdf modelling pdf modelling pdf download. In previous works 14, 15, we have presented a generic multilevel modeling framework for etl processes. Actor model, software framework, agentbased simulation, distributed system, java. Also included would be the various ways to categorize the questions and the elements of the trash lifecycle they address. Nonetheless, to effectively design and implement analytics systems is a nontrivial task. A model migration case for the transformation tool contest arxiv.
A conceptual framework and comparison of spatial data. In the framework presented in this paper, the central modeling element is the concept of features. From your design of such a model, the databases schema and corresponding python classes are automatically generated. Statistics in the modern day 1 part i computing 15 chapter 2. Data warehousing, etl, conceptual modeling, logical modeling. Emp as a tool for the creation of graphical editors for user defined.
An evaluation of the graphical modeling framework gmf based. Therefore, we would like a framework that prepares for this lifelong learning problem, while keeping data management to a minimum. Highquality representations are critical to that understanding. How it works soft link between cmf document item and business object relationship will not show in whereused.
Chair of systems design weinbergstrasse 5658 ch8092, zurich, switzerland. Gmf core is software package ready to be installed on variety of os and gmf modules are plugins that extend core to provide user possibilities. Introduction our goal is to provide a methodology for facilitating the modeling and management of etl extractiontransformationloading processes. We provide a high level introduction to these frameworks so that eclipse plug. Then, a main application of mp systems to systems biology will be outlined, which concerns gene expression in breast cancer in cooperation with karmanos cancer institute, wayne state university, detroit mi, usa. This tutorial describes the functionality provided by gmf in version 2. This paper will present the ch model as one way to approach such a topic, which has led to an agent that won the 2011 lsg competition 15. Despite years of progress, contemporary tools often provide limited support for feature constraints and offer little or no support for debugging feature models. Geoframework is based on and extends pyre, a pythonbased modeling framework, recently developed to link solid lagrangian and fluid eulerian models, as well as mesh generators, visualization. In this chapter, a conceptual framework for the study is built, based on school effectiveness models and factors indicated in literature that influence science achievement of students. Gmf tooling the gmf tooling project provides a modeldriven approach to generating graphical editors in eclipse. A framework for modeling population strategies by depth of. This document expands on the exiting durable models document and explains a process that can be followed in 8. Modeling framework gmf project was recently assigned to.
Williams learn data modeling by example part 2 10 6. It allows one to clearly describe multiscale, multiscience phenomena, separating the problemspecific components from the strategy used to deal with a large range of scales. Graphical modeling framework the eclipse foundation. Hence, for a particular model, we have the dual choice ofan augmentation scheme anda parametrization.
Reflections on influential articles from cartographica ed m. A framework for understanding and analysing ebusiness models 5. It provides a generative component and runtime infrastructure for developing graphical editors based on the eclipse modeling framework emf and graphical editing framework gef. The graphical modeling framework gmf is a framework within the eclipse platform.
Pdf an information modeling framework for bridge monitoring. This tutorial will introduce the graphical modeling framework, an eclipse modeling project project that aims to provide a generative bridge between the eclipse modeling framework and graphical editing framework in this tutorial, a mindmap application will be developed, as described here. Most tasks require a person or an automated system to reasonto reach conclusions based on available information. Convergence of model frameworks and data frameworks. The eclipse foundation home to a global community, the eclipse ide, jakarta ee and over 350 open source projects, including runtimes, tools and frameworks. We present an evaluation of the graphical modeling framework gmf 5 based on the experiences we got from developing a graphical editor for. Exemplary mdd submission using gmf and m2m for modeldrivendevelopment submission. It gives developers a full solution for graphical modeling of a java object model, and it can be used in conjunction with other technologies such as emf. This paper proposes a comprehensive conceptual modeling quality framework, bringing together two wellknown quality frameworks.
Gef and draw2d provide the foundations for building graphical views for emf and other models types. Right click on the ecore file and select new other simple graphical definition model from the context menu graphical modeling framework category. Conceptual model ing, its artefacts and requirements are then defined. Now unified into a number of dynamical cores and physics options within a single framework for running solo and coupled models on parallel hardware. In this paper, we introduce the code software framework and discuss its use for agentbased simulation. The project aims to provide these components, in addition to exemplary tools for select domain models which illustrate its capabilities. Graphical modeling frameworktutorialpart 1 eclipsepedia. The process of determining what to model is known as conceptual modeling. Within tarsier all data types are identified as classes, and the kernel of the tarsier framework manages the objects formed by instances of. Conceptual model the following framework suggests ways to represent the relationship among management questions associated with a receiving waters trash monitoring programs and the various monitoring methods that may inform those questions. Blaha patterns of data modeling 10 hardcoded tree use when. Pdf an evaluation of the graphical modeling framework gmf. Graphical modeling frameworkdocumentation eclipsepedia.
Prism program for integrated earth system modeling 2001. While evaluation approaches for conceptual modeling languages do exist, e. For example, when we think about houses, we implicitly include bungalows and ski lodges, and maybe even apartments, beach huts and. Tarsier is an environmental modelling framework constructed primarily on data sharing and message passing principles using the observer pattern of software engineering design gamma et al. The modeling framework intends to fill the gap between the python object world and relational databases. Conceptual framework for modelling and analysing periurban land problems in southern africa.
A general framework for constructing and using probabilistic models of complex systems that would enable a computer to use available information for making decisions. Rmf consists of a core allowing reading, writing and manipulating reqif data, and a user interface allowing to inspect and edit request data. We can see examples of inheritance in practice when we look around us every day. Pdf we present an evaluation of the graphical modeling framework gmf based on our experiences in developing an editor for the risk modeling language. Introduction to the graphical modeling framework network domain demo submission gmf. An ontology oriented architecture for context aware. In practice, used for examples, but seldom for code. A multiscale modelling framework and a corresponding modelling language is an important step in this direction. A framework for the generalization of 3d city models. Toward this end, a clothing modeling framework for quantifying the mechanical interactions between a given clothing system design and a specific wearer performing defined physical tasks is proposed. Graphical modeling framework api many platform plugins in the rational uml modeling products were moved to the eclipse open source graphical modeling framework gmf project and the required namespace changes were applied. This section provides information on how to access data in the. A framework for understanding and analysing ebusiness.
605 72 1436 1636 1277 615 1451 1248 1155 369 863 167 1395 1246 711 36 1606 130 1448 264 1054 811 627 518 1409 653 417 445 109 475